Jacob Collier
Born in London in 1994 into a family of British musicians, Jacob Collier first came to attention in the early 2010s with online videos of covers and polyphonic arrangements in which he layered voices and instruments in a highly visual format. A multi‑instrumentalist and singer, Collier has developed an oeuvre at the crossroads of jazz, pop, R&B and choral music, marked by dense harmonies, frequent metric changes and a taste for collective vocal architectures. His debut studio album, “In My Room”, was released in 2016 and established the basis for largely self‑produced work, continued by the “Djesse” cycle — a series of four volumes issued between 2018 and 2024 that respectively explore chamber‑music atmospheres, orchestral acoustic textures, electronic pop and song‑oriented formats. Alongside his solo projects, Collier occasionally collaborates with artists from jazz, pop and film music such as Herbie Hancock and Hans Zimmer, and translates his experiments in collective arranging to the stage, from expanded solo concerts to band tours on international stages.
